Windshield molding

Anyone have any tips on removing windshield molding. Car going to paint an I want to replace instead of taping it up. Hop it can be removed without damaging windshield. Tried removing with picks but it seems very brittle.

It just pushes in. It's a T shape with ridges to grab the windshield and frame. Other than tension, the only thing that holds it in is if the window urethane squeezed out from under the glass.

Chances are pretty good that if you get it out, you won't want to reinstall it. It'll be hard, and warped, and generally not in any condition to go back on a car. Windshield installers generally will replace the strip with a new piece that's a bit larger than stock.
